Understanding 控制 (kòng zhì): Meaning, Grammar, and Usage

If you are delving into the nuances of the Chinese language, the term 控制 (kòng zhì) is an essential one to understand. This article will explore the meaning of 控制, its grammatical structure, and provide example sentences to solidify your understanding.

What Does 控制 (kòng zhì) Mean?

In Chinese, 控制 (kòng zhì) means “to control” or “to manage.” It encompasses a range of applications from personal self-control to broader contexts such as controlling a situation, organization, or even emotions. The verb is widely used in everyday situations, making it crucial for learners of the language.

Breaking Down the Terms

The term 控制 consists of two characters:

  • 控 (kòng): This character means “to restrain” or “to limit.” It sets the tone for the meaning of control, implying not just authority but also regulation.
  • 制 (zhì): This character means “to establish” or “to systematize.” It contributes to the idea of systematically managing or setting rules.

Grammatical Structure of 控制 Chinese vocabulary

In terms of grammar, 控制 can function as both a verb and a noun, depending on the context. Here is how it can be structured in a sentence:

Using 控制 as a Verb

When used as a verb, 控制 follows the typical subject-verb-object (SVO) structure of Chinese sentences.

  • Subject + 控制 + Object

Using 控制 as a Noun

As a noun, 控制 functions similarly and can often be used with modifiers.

  • Modifier + 控制

Example Sentences Using 控制

Verb Usage

Here are some example sentences illustrating how 控制 is used as a verb:

  • 我想控制我的饮食。 (Wǒ xiǎng kòng zhì wǒ de yǐn shí.) – “I want to control my diet.”
  • 他必须控制他的情绪。 (Tā bì xū kòng zhì tā de qíng xù.) – “He must control his emotions.”
  • 老师控制课堂纪律。 (Lǎo shī kòng zhì kè táng jì lǜ.) – “The teacher controls the classroom discipline.”

Noun Usage

Now, let’s look at some sentences where 控制 is used as a noun:

  • 他对局势的控制能力很强。 (Tā duì jú shì de kòng zhì néng lì hěn qiáng.) – “He has strong control over the situation.”
  • 团队的控制是成功的关键。 (Tuán duì de kòng zhì shì chéng gōng de guān jiàn.) – “The control of the team is the key to success.” example sentences in Chinese
  • 有效的控制可以提高生产率。 (Yǒu xiào de kòng zhì kě yǐ tí gāo shēng chǎn lǜ.) – “Effective control can increase productivity.”
